Care to Grow is a charity dedicated to supporting children’s wellbeing and emotional literacy. By training trusted adults in schools, the organisation helps children build the resilience and emotional tools they need to thrive in education and in life.
The role of Volunteer Buddies involves providing weekly check-ins with children who need extra support, giving them a meaningful break from the classroom, helping them feel more regulated, and enabling them to return to learning ready to engage. “This isn’t about being an expert, it’s about showing up consistently, building a genuine relationship, and becoming a trusted adult in a child’s life.”
